What is an I O device error Windows 10?
An I/O machine error (short for “I/O device error”) can occur when Windows is unable to perform an I/O action (such as concurrently reading or copying data) while attempting to access a disk or alternate disk access. It can show up on many types of devices or tracking hardware.

What are the causes of Io error on USB drive?
Causes of USB I/O errors 1 Hard drive is damaged 2 Hardware drivers are corrupted or simply incompatible 3 Connection problems such as a bad cable 4 USB game controllers are unstable or damaged
